Sport has become deeply embedded in modern culture, influencing various social institutions like education, economics, and politics. Mass participation in sports, particularly association football, has surged, with the game being played by two teams of eleven on a rectangular field. The objective is to score by getting the ball into the opposing team's goal, with only goalkeepers permitted to use their hands. Women's association football has emerged as a leading team sport for women globally, highlighting the sport's widespread appeal and significance in contemporary society.
